El restaurante Cocina Hermanos Torres es un concepto en el que modernidad y creatividad confluyen, un laboratorio de innovación situado en una antigua nave industrial de 800 metros cuadrados ubicada en el barrio barcelonés de Les Corts y con capacidad de hasta 200 comensales. Centro y corazón del proyecto, la sala principal es una cocina abierta, formativa y cultural, donde el invitado es el máximo protagonista de su propia experiencia: no se trata de un comedor, sino de una cocina en la que se come. Un Sommelier en Cocina Hermanos Torres es el encargado de la preparación y mise en place de vinos, recepción de pedidos, gestión y organización de la bodega y servicios de vinos al comensal.
